Payables Manager information

What does a payables manager do?

A Payables Manager oversees an organization's accounts payable department, ensuring that all outgoing payments to vendors and suppliers are accurate, timely, and compliant with company policies. They manage staff, implement procedures to streamline invoice processing, and maintain relationships with external vendors. Additionally, Payables Managers often collaborate with internal departments to resolve discrepancies and help improve the company's cash flow management. Their role is crucial in preventing late payments, avoiding penalties, and maintaining a smooth procurement process.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a payables manager?

To thrive as a Payables Manager, you need strong accounting knowledge, attention to detail, and typically a bachelor’s degree in finance or accounting. Familiarity with ERP systems like SAP or Oracle, as well as proficiency in Excel and accounts payable automation tools, is essential. Leadership, problem-solving, and effective communication are crucial soft skills for managing teams and collaborating across departments. These skills ensure accurate financial processing, compliance, and efficient operations within the payables function.

What are the most common challenges faced by a payables manager, and how can they be addressed?

Payables Managers often encounter challenges such as maintaining accuracy in high-volume invoice processing, ensuring timely payments to avoid penalties, and managing relationships with vendors. These challenges can be addressed by implementing robust internal controls, leveraging automation tools to streamline repetitive tasks, and fostering clear communication within the finance team and with external partners. Staying updated on compliance requirements and regularly reviewing processes also helps minimize errors and improve overall efficiency.

What is the difference between Payables Manager vs Accounts Payable Specialist?

AspectPayables ManagerAccounts Payable Specialist
ResponsibilitiesOversees the entire accounts payable process, manages team, ensures timely payments, and maintains vendor relationships.Processes invoices, verifies expenses, and ensures accurate data entry for accounts payable transactions.
Required CredentialsBachelor's degree in accounting or finance; experience in accounts payable; leadership skills.High school diploma or associate degree; experience with invoice processing and accounting software.
Work EnvironmentOffice setting, often in finance or accounting departments, with managerial responsibilities.Office environment, focused on transactional processing and data entry tasks.

The main difference between a Payables Manager and an Accounts Payable Specialist lies in scope and responsibility. The Payables Manager oversees the entire accounts payable process, manages staff, and maintains vendor relationships, while the Accounts Payable Specialist handles day-to-day invoice processing and data entry. Both roles require accounting knowledge, but the manager position involves leadership and strategic oversight.

The American Automobile Association (AAA), headquartered in Heathrow, Florida, USA, is a reputable force in the automotive and insurance industry. Originating in 1902, it began as a coalition of motor clubs with the common goal of providing better roads and travel conditions for motorists. Today, AAA is a comprehensive, multifaceted organization that offers a range of services, including roadside assistance, auto repair services, travel agency services, and diverse insurance products - Auto, Home, Life and more. A significant principle for AAA is to continuously deliver value to their 61 million members through safety, security and peace of mind. The company's mission and core values focus on championing its members' rights and interests, advocating innovation, integrity, teamwork and respect.
